Output 30156be66d97b3d1fe4c950e69a87b4951e9467f8de35664a21d2f202e700374:0

value
4103590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ad97d72edec167a6ed1d02e98eabe40b99b97aab OP_EQUALVERIFY OP_CHECKSIG
address
Lb3q4U27gSucbhwPZeQe1VG3Kix8JSzm9A
transaction
30156be66d97b3d1fe4c950e69a87b4951e9467f8de35664a21d2f202e700374
spent
true